永发信息网

excel复制公式,插入复制后绝对引用位置变为新复制的位置。

答案:3  悬赏:0  手机版
解决时间 2021-11-10 11:40
excel复制公式,插入复制后绝对引用位置变为新复制的位置。
最佳答案
加绝对引用符是为了右拉下拉时,列标或行号不随之变化,保证填充时还能引用到原列中的数据。
刚才看了下,如果用相对引用修改公式会变得很复杂,不合算,还不如用替换方法,来得简便:
    AN226输入公式:=IF($AJ226="","",($AH226*10+$AH227=AN$3)+IFERROR(LOOKUP(1,0/($AJ$225:$AJ225=$AJ226),AN$225:AN225),0)),右拉至AV226,这里是直接拖动填充柄向右填充,不用直接修改公式的列标;
    选中AN226:AV226区域,开始--查找和选择--替换(或直接按Ctrl+H快捷键),查找内容输入:$A,替换内容输入:A,全部替换,这样就可以将9个公式中的列标前的绝对引用符$全部去掉(这里是假设第一次输入公式是在图中的范围,否则列标不是A开头,就要用其它替换方法,或者直接一个一个的去掉9个公式中列标前的$,但行号前的$不能去除);


    可以看到列标前的$全部消失,成现在的样式;

    AW226输入:=IFERROR(IF(MAX(OFFSET(AN225:AP225,,INT((MATCH(AH225*10+AH226,AN$3:AV$3,0)-1)/3)*3))>MEDIAN(OFFSET(AN225:AP225,,INT((MATCH(AH225*10+AH226,AN$3:AV$3,0)-1)/3)*3)),1,""),"");
    AX226输入:=IFERROR(IF((COUNTIF(OFFSET(AN225:AP225,,INT((MATCH(AH225*10+AH226,AN$3:AV$3,0)-1)/3)*3),0)=2)*(MAX(OFFSET(AN225:AP225,,INT((MATCH(AH225*10+AH226,AN$3:AV$3,0)-1)/3)*3))>1),1,""),""),这里比原公式多加了IFERROR函数判断,避免下拉太多时出现#N/A;
    这里AW226、AX226由于不需要右拉填充,公式已直接将列标前的$去除,如果已经输入,不想重输,只要在替换前扩大选中范围至AN226:AX226,一起替换即可;
    经过这样处理后,列已全部成为相对引用,以后复制到任何列,公式都无须更改。

全部回答
看不到图。。。。。。。。。。。。。。。。。
太复杂了,你能举简单的例子吗?感觉文本地址函数indirect()是你要的,偏移函数offset()取数,或区域也是你要的。
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
投笔从戎历史人物是谁的
姓张的女闺密备注什么好
股指期货怎么样好做吗
非洲足球为什么也比中国强?
九州美食城在什么地方啊,我要过去处理事情
定西市卫生学校附属医院办公地址在什么地方,
java中100和3.0取余是多少
德观茶庄地址在什么地方,我要处理点事!
5.07X2.85怎样计算
芹菜炒大虾的做法
迅雷下载到99.9%就不动了,怎么办??
西方文明起源和亚非文明起源有何不同
你以为你猴塞雷啊丢雷楼某什么意思
我经朋友介绍买了2800元完美玛丽艳化妆品,其
有用大象避孕套破的么?
推荐资讯
奥数题 ,30个学生,会骑车12人,会游泳18人,
乐理中 音数相同就一定是等音程吗
梦见大路有凹的地方
为什么说如果利用时间机器回到过去会违反因果
中国足球队历史上最厉害的前锋是谁?
人类在地球上生息的息是什么意思
一彬照明商场地址在什么地方,想过去办事,
华宇物流地址在什么地方,想过去办事,
L188次列车24号广州东到重庆北的加班车到重庆
对于晚饭的时间,一般应该在晚上几点比较
小学生自助金怎么写申请
月利率0.5%是多少
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?